1
0
Fork 0
mirror of https://github.com/Chocobozzz/PeerTube.git synced 2025-10-03 17:59:37 +02:00

Don't publish video before audio stream

This commit is contained in:
Chocobozzz 2025-01-31 07:04:34 +01:00
parent f099067e9d
commit 23cd92430f
No known key found for this signature in database
GPG key ID: 583A612D890159BE
6 changed files with 47 additions and 8 deletions

View file

@ -83,7 +83,7 @@ export abstract class AbstractJobBuilder <P> {
this.buildHLSJobPayload({
deleteWebVideoFiles: !CONFIG.TRANSCODING.WEB_VIDEOS.ENABLED && !hasSplitAudioTranscoding,
separatedAudio: CONFIG.TRANSCODING.HLS.SPLIT_AUDIO_AND_VIDEO,
separatedAudio: hasSplitAudioTranscoding,
copyCodecs,
@ -103,7 +103,7 @@ export abstract class AbstractJobBuilder <P> {
...this.buildHLSJobPayload({
deleteWebVideoFiles: !CONFIG.TRANSCODING.WEB_VIDEOS.ENABLED,
separatedAudio: CONFIG.TRANSCODING.HLS.SPLIT_AUDIO_AND_VIDEO,
separatedAudio: hasSplitAudioTranscoding,
copyCodecs,
resolution: 0,
@ -248,7 +248,7 @@ export abstract class AbstractJobBuilder <P> {
resolution,
fps,
isNewVideo,
separatedAudio: CONFIG.TRANSCODING.HLS.SPLIT_AUDIO_AND_VIDEO,
separatedAudio: hasAudio && CONFIG.TRANSCODING.HLS.SPLIT_AUDIO_AND_VIDEO,
copyCodecs: CONFIG.TRANSCODING.WEB_VIDEOS.ENABLED
})
)